Using hostname of pc
This would be handy. Every FTP I have done has always failed with the hostname. IP worked every time. Though there was one Minolta that hostname did work. SMB has worked for both hostname and IP for me.
Host name for FTP will work best when you are on a domain and the FTP server is a service on one of your domain servers. In that case the host becomes yourdomain.com or in some cases ftp.yourdomain.com.
check the copier settings do a ipconfig \all make sure to enter dns and wins settings also domain name
other option is make that pc a static ipaddress if hostname fails
